What is ICD-10 code T49?
T49 is an ICD-10-CM diagnosis code for Poisoning by, adverse effect of and underdosing of topical agents primarily affecting skin and mucous membrane and by ophthalmological, otorhinorlaryngological and dental drugs.
Is T49 a billable code?
No. T49 is a category/header code, not billable on its own — use one of its more specific child codes instead.
What ICD-10-CM chapter is T49 in?
T49 falls under Chapter 19: Injury, poisoning and certain other consequences of external causes.
